Kimberley Guide

Kimberley in South Africa will always be synonymous with the rich and often sad history of diamond mining, and is effectively in the middle of the country.

Top Things to do and see in Kimberley

A visit to the vast Big Hole, in the middle of the town, shows where miners dug with picks and shovels to try to access the diamond riches deep underground.

Take a day out at Mokala National Park, the newest National Park in South Africa, and try to spot all sorts of wildlife, including white and black rhinos.

See the Diggers' Memorial, a powerful sculpture in honour of past and present diggers.

Cultural Attractions

The middle of South Africa may not appear to be a place to find a collection of 16th and 17th Century Flemish and Dutch Old Masters, but they are there for art lovers in the William Humphreys Art Gallery. The Big Hole and Kimberley Mine Museum is a major draw for the history of diamond mining and the opportunity to go underground as well as peer into the gigantic manmade hole itself.
